24 MWp for 2000 photovoltaic pump systems

The project involves the installation of 2,000 photovoltaic pumping systems (PVPS). The aim is to create sustainable irrigation solutions for agriculture by utilising solar energy to pump water efficiently and reduce CO₂ emissions at the same time. The project is located in the north-east of Bogra district, Bangladesh. PUBL Bangladesh and BREB Bangladesh are involved as project partners. Financing is provided by the Asian Development Bank (ADB).

20 MWp photovoltaics - 5MVA wind - 20MWh battery power plant for stand-alone operation

The project comprises the development of a 20 MWp photovoltaic and 5 MVA wind power plant. The aim is to strengthen renewable energy generation and create sustainable sources of electricity, particularly in regions with high energy requirements and limited resources. Arabian African GmbH & Co KG and Sea Ports Corporation (SPC) are involved as project partners. The project was financed by the Sea Ports Corporation (SPC) and the Ministry of Transport of the Republic of Sudan.

20 MWp photovoltaic hybrid power plant

The project is concerned with the feasibility study for a 20 MWp photovoltaic system. The aim is to examine the technical and economic feasibility of a large-scale solar energy project that could sustainably improve the local energy supply. The project site is located in Siguiri, Guinea. The project partners are AngloGold Ashanti, CSE Senegal and the Republic of Guinea.
